How to survive the flight to Mortain?
If you’re poorly prepared, air travel can be tough. But there’s no need to panic. Follow these useful tips for a stress-free start to your getaway in Mortain.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• First, put in your passport, official ID, cash and daily medications. Next, you’ll want some entertainment to while away the time. A juicy book and a tablet crammed with your favorite shows are some terrific options. If you intend to take a quick nap, a neck pillow and a pair of earplugs will also be useful. Finally, make room for a toothbrush and some facial wipes so you’ll step off the plane looking fresh and ready to go.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Check carefully that you don’t have sharp objects (like a knife or scissors) hiding in one of the zippers of your carry-on luggage. Other prohibited items include explosive or flammable products, like aerosols and matches, and gels and liquids in containers lar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).

What to wear on a flight:

  • The best way to ensure a comfortable flight is as simple as your choice of clothing. Prepare for temperature changes by bringing layers. This will keep you nice and warm if the cabin begins to cool down. Shoes like sandals and heels are best left in your suitcase. Even though they may be your favorites, go for flat, closed-toed footwear like sneakers. Your feet will thank you later.
  • A condition known as DVT (deep vein thrombosis) can pose a risk on long-haul flights. It’s the result of blood clotting due to inactivity and poor circulation. Walking up and down the aisle and doing foot and leg exercises in your seat is a great way to prevent this from happening. Wearing a good pair of compression socks is also a wise idea.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Mortain?
As seasoned travelers know, the secret is to be well organized before you arrive at security. That way, you’ll be hopping onto that plane to Mortain in next to no time. Follow these helpful tips and get your vacation off to a fantastic start:

  • Your travel documents and passport will need to be inspected by airport security personnel. Keep them at hand so you don’t hold up the line.
  • The X-ray machine is up next. Remove anything metal on you that is likely to set off the alarm. This includes items like earphones or headphones, as well as your coat or jacket. They’ll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• Your electronic devices like laptops and phones will also need to go on a tray to be scanned. No need to worry though, you’ll be back online before you know it.
  • Can’t travel without your favorite cologne or perfume? As long as the volume is no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and it’s stored in a clear zip-close bag, it’s fine to bring with you in your carry-on luggage.
  • There’s a chance you’ll be asked to remove your shoes for scanning, so wearing slip-on sneakers is always a clever idea.
  • Take all prohibited items out of your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, put them in your checked suitcase. They won’t be allowed in the cabin.
